Engineering, Computing & Technology

Explore archive content from our portfolio of engineering, computing and technology journals.



The Engineering, Computing & Technology Archive is split into the Classic Archive, the Modern Archive Part I and Part II.

  • The Classic Archive, covering research published before 1996, back to the first journal volume where available.
  • The Modern Archive Part I covers more recent scholarship published from 1997-2006.
  • The Modern Archive Part II, which picks up where Part I leaves off and covers research published from 2007-2011.
